| Los Angeles, CA – December 9, 2025 – Donkey Crew, in partnership with Snail Games USA, has today greatly expanded their medieval open-world survival RPG Bellwright with its largest update yet. Titled “Maiden Voyage”, this massive free expansion offers a vast new map with a story-driven questline, fresh challenges, exclusive loot, and major new progression systems. Newcomers can even snag Bellwright for 34% off through December 17th. |
| The biggest addition to Bellwright is the new Halmare Isles map, which is roughly 25% the size of the original game! At over 10 square kilometers, this region includes all new story-based quests with multiple progression lines, expanded armor and equipment, new animals and buildings, and introduces a Loyalty & Faction system. Other major additions to the core game include full controller support, a Trade and Caravans feature that provides a new layer of strategy as players build and manage a sophisticated logistics network between their outposts, and an improved Walls fortification system that allows players to construct walls for their camps. This includes new gameplay mechanics with specific AI behavior for attackers and defenders, which adds a fresh challenge and more strategic depth to base defense. There’s a bounty of new customization features as well, like a much improved Character Creator, offering further options and higher fidelity player character models. Fashion-conscious players will also enjoy the New Weapon Types & Cloaks offering more ways to personalize player characters and show off their unique builds and looks. Another quality of life improvement is the addition of Blocking Markers on Building Placement, with a new system that now shows foliage blocking construction areas, along with the ability to task workers with removing the foliage before it is built. |

Chongqing, China – 4th December: Pathea Games, the studio behind the beloved life-sim series My Time, is delighted to unveil ‘The God Slayer’ – a new third-person, open-world steampunk fantasy, roleplaying game in development for PC, PlayStation 5 and Xbox platforms.
Enter an Eastern-inspired steampunk metropolis where gods known as Celestials reign with a divine fist! In this premium open-world RPG, you are an Elemancer who refuses to bow to his creators. Infused with elemental powers and a heart of vengeance, you will dethrone them all. You will rise to be The God Slayer.
To get a flavour of this exciting new universe, please watch the CGI cinematic and gameplay trailer here: https://youtu.be/OqN2-oPbne4

Long ago, the god‑like Celestials created the human world and all living things in it, designing everything to cultivate a powerful force known as ‘Qi’ to fuel their eternal lives. In this new age, humanity has learned to channel that same qi energy into elemental powers, wielding fire, water, earth, metal and wood through flowing, martial‑artistry. Outraged that their divine energy is being used by mere mortals, the Celestials make a brutal example of humanity by conquering the strongest kingdom in the land in a single night — hunting down and killing the king and the kingdom’s Elemancers. An event remembered as the God Fall.
In this 40-hour story-driven campaign, players assume the role of one of these gifted Elemancers, Cheng, as he seeks to galvanise a resistance against the merciless Celestials. Imbued with a sense of power and anger at the loss of his own family during the God Fall, Cheng embarks on a journey to change his world, avenge the fallen, and slay the gods that have wronged him.
“Thematically The God Slayer is a big departure from what Pathea is known for, namely the My Time series,” explained Zifei Wu, founder and creative director at Pathea. “However we’ve made multiple open-world RPGs before, filled with beloved characters and varied systems for players to experiment with and flourish. The God Slayer has all that and more with our talented development team attempting something darker and more serious in tone, bolstered by thrilling elemental combat at its core.”
Featuring a darker tone than Pathea’s previous games, The God Slayer, features freeform RPG gameplay that players love with fully customisable elemental combat, a giant capital city named Zhou to explore, factions to befriend or belittle, and mission design that enables players to make different choices in how they achieve their objectives.
This exciting new release was first mentioned as part of Sony Interactive Entertainment’s ‘China Hero Project’ at ChinaJoy in 2023. Over the past two years Pathea has been crafting and refining their vision to create a truly immersive open-world story-driven experience.

- A Reactive Steampunk Metropolis
Lose yourself in a unique fantasy steampunk setting, enhanced with Eastern flair. Set foot in the capital city of the Zhou Kingdom, an urban metropolis that is experiencing a technological revolution, with an assortment of airships, steamboats, monorails, and steam vehicles. A fortunate few in the upper class savor the miracle of air-conditioned homes and mechanical washing drums, while in the poor neighborhoods the vast majority still toil in soot-blackened factories or bow beneath the weight of noble privilege. - Customisable Elemental Combat
Combine water, earth, metal and fire to create powerful attacks and weaponry. Use these abilities to bend the environment to your whim and in direct combat. Experiment with different strategic options and create your own fully customisable fighting style to dominate enemies big and small. Every encounter is a challenge, every battle a chance to unleash thrilling elemental combos that scratch your creative itch. - Confront Challenges Your Way
Missions in The God Slayer will allow players to approach them in multiple ways. For instance, players are free to attack all enemies head-on, they can bribe guards to look the other way, they can activate elemental powers to create diversions / distract enemies, they can pathfind usually hidden side routes and utilize other means to achieve their objective. - A Story of Vengeance
Embark on a thrilling story-driven campaign filled with interesting characters and intriguing twists and turns. Choose your allies, inspire people across the city, and overthrow scheming gods to bring justice to the world.

Cloudheim Launches in Early Access Today, Bringing Physics-Fueled Co-op Chaos to Steam and EpicUnited States, December 4th, 2025 – Noodle Cat Games is happy to announce that Cloudheim, a physics-based action-RPG built for online co-op, is now available in Early Access on Steam and Epic Game Store for $29.99 / €28.99 / £24.99; with a 10% discount at launch and the Supporter’s Pack DLC included with each purchase which includes:Extra Characters: Brooks, Jarl Erland, Emma, SylfEmotes: Jellycow Express, Catch a Ride, Galloping Greeble, Ninja Rush, Sign UwU, Runari Stride, Gnasher Strut, Sign Broken BrooksBifröst Character Style: Show off your support with this cosmic style line, available for 26 characters!Players can finally dive into Cloudheim’s chaotic world, teaming up in physics-driven co-op combat, experimenting with wild weapon combinations while exploring a colorful, Norse-inspired landscape. Smash, toss, and juggle enemies in creative ways, craft gear on the fly and uncover hidden secrets as you adventure together.Watch the Cloudheim Early Access Out Now trailer:Following the overwhelming response during Steam Next Fest – where Cloudheim was in the top 50 most played demos out of thousands – the Early Access launch greatly expands what players have seen so far. New islands, additional dungeons, deeper crafting options, and expanded base-building systems are all available from day one. The Noodle Cat Games team is committed to working closely with the community throughout Early Access to refine, improve, and grow Cloudheim with consistent updates shaped by player feedback such as bug fixes and localisation.”We’re extremely excited to launch Cloudheim into Early Access,” said David Hunt, CEO, Founder, and Game Designer at Noodle Cat Games. “The response to the demo has been incredible, and we can’t wait for players to experience everything we’ve added. We have retooled a lot of Cloudheim with the help of players – like improving the physics-system, majors upgrades to the shop, and jump behavior. Cloudheim in Early Access already includes the campaign, up to 4-player co-op, and all main systems in place, and it’s just the beginning – we have big plans for future updates with new weapons, characters, islands, and other content shaped by community feedback. We’re eager to build Cloudheim together with our players.” Cloudheim is a vibrant action-RPG built for co-op chaos and creative physics-based combat. Up to four players can team up to unleash mayhem in a world where almost everything can be destroyed or weaponized. Smash pillars onto enemies – the physics system ensures no two battles play out the same.Explore diverse islands and mysterious dungeons while expanding and customizing the Odin Shell, your flying turtle base. Build out your crafting empire, decorate the island, run a thriving shop, and uncover hidden secrets as your airborne fortress grows along with your adventure.![]() Cloudheim’s Key Features:Physics-Driven Combat: Lasso, launch, and juggle enemies into fire pits, each other, or the scenery—anything goes. Longer air time = more damage. Real-Time Crafting & Fusion: Grab and toss materials directly into crafting stations in the world. No menus, no inventory clutter—just pure, visible teamwork.Drop-In 4-Player Co-Op: Tame creatures, fight bosses, and explore mythic dungeons with friends. All loot is shared; your progression is not.Evolving Base & Shop System: Return from adventures to upgrade your base, sell loot, and unlock new features.Stylized Fantasy World: Built by a team of experienced artists, Cloudheim is rich with visual flair, character, and discovery.![]() ![]() |

November 28, 2025 – AFK Journey, published by Farlight Games and available on iOS, Android, and PC, announces the worldwide release of the crossover event with the popular anime “Delicious in Dungeon,” starting today and running through December 26, 2025. The crossover story follows two characters from “Delicious in Dungeon” who accidentally find themselves in the world of Esperia. With the help of Magister Merlin, they manage to find their way back to the dungeon. You will be able to enjoy monster cuisines and exclusive content from “Delicious in Dungeon.” Dinner is ready!

Progress Through Underground Stages as You Explore the Dungeon
Inspired by the anime “Delicious in Dungeon,” the dungeon in this event features multiple floors. Each floor is divided into different areas based on monster attributes, and you can earn rewards or ingredients from each battle. But that’s not all!
There are also new side quests and boss challenges. In the special cooking system, different ingredient combinations grant various combat buffs! Have fun participating in this crossover event!
